Quick Family Meals
When time is short, quick family meals become essential. Here are some effective options:
- Pasta Dishes: Pasta cooks quickly and pairs well with various sauces and proteins. For example, spaghetti with marinara sauce and ground turkey takes about 20 minutes.
- Stir-Fries: These are versatile and fast. Use pre-cut vegetables and your choice of protein—chicken, tofu, or shrimp—and sauté them in a wok or large skillet for about 15 minutes.
- One-Pot Meals: Combine your protein, vegetables, and grains in one pot for easy cleanup. A chicken and rice dish can be ready in under 30 minutes by using quick-cooking rice.
- Sheet Pan Dinners: Toss your favorite veggies and protein on a sheet pan with olive oil and seasonings; roast at 425°F for around 25-30 minutes.
Planning Easy Family Meals
Planning ahead simplifies weeknight cooking. Consider these steps:
- Create a Weekly Menu: Dedicate time each week to plan out meals based on what you have on hand.
- Batch Cook Staples: Prepare large batches of grains like quinoa or brown rice to use throughout the week.
- Use Leftovers Creatively: Transform last night’s stir-fry into fried rice for lunch the next day.
Healthy Recipes for Families
Healthy meals do not need to be complicated. Focus on incorporating lean proteins, whole grains, and plenty of vegetables:
- Grilled Chicken Tacos: Marinate chicken breasts in lime juice and spices before grilling them quickly on high heat.
- Vegetable Soup: A hearty soup can be made by simmering chopped vegetables in broth; add beans for extra protein.
- Oven-Baked Salmon with Asparagus: Season salmon fillets with herbs; bake alongside asparagus at 400°F for about 15 minutes.
Budget-Friendly Cooking
Eating healthy doesn’t have to break the bank. Here are some budget-friendly tips:
- Buy Seasonal Produce: Fresh fruits and vegetables are often cheaper when they are in season.
- Choose Store Brands: Opting for store brands instead of name brands can save money without sacrificing quality.
- Plan Around Sales: Check weekly grocery ads to plan meals based on what’s on sale.
What Are Some Quick Dinner Ideas?
Here are several quick dinner ideas that require minimal prep time while still being filling:
- Quesadillas filled with cheese, beans, and any leftover meats or veggies can be made in under 10 minutes.
- A simple salad topped with grilled shrimp or canned tuna makes for a refreshing meal that’s ready in less than 15 minutes.
- Breakfast-for-dinner options like scrambled eggs served with toast or breakfast burritos can also be prepared quickly.
